estrutura DXVADDI_VIDEOPROCESSORINPUT (d3dumddi.h)
A estrutura DXVADDI_VIDEOPROCESSORINPUT descreve um fluxo de vídeo processado por um tipo de dispositivo de processamento de vídeo.
Sintaxe
typedef struct _DXVADDI_VIDEOPROCESSORINPUT {
[in] const GUID *pVideoProcGuid;
[in] DXVADDI_VIDEODESC VideoDesc;
[in] D3DDDIFORMAT RenderTargetFormat;
} DXVADDI_VIDEOPROCESSORINPUT;
Membros
[in] pVideoProcGuid
Um ponteiro para um GUID que representa o tipo de dispositivo de processamento de vídeo.
[in] VideoDesc
Uma estrutura DXVADDI_VIDEODESC que descreve o fluxo de vídeo.
[in] RenderTargetFormat
Um valor de tipo D3DDDIFORMAT que indica o formato de pixel do destino de renderização para o dispositivo de processamento de vídeo.
Comentários
Quando o valor D3DDDICAPS_GETVIDEOPROCESSORRTFORMATCOUNT, D3DDDICAPS_GETVIDEOPROCESSORRTFORMATS, D3DDDICAPS_GETVIDEOPROCESSORRTSUBSTREAMFORMATCOUNT ou D3DDDICAPS_GETVIDEOPROCESSORRTSUBSTREAMFORMATS tipo de D3DDDICAPS_TYPE é enviado em uma chamada para a função GetCaps do driver de exibição no modo de usuário, o driver ignora o membro RenderTargetFormat do DXVADDI_VIDEOPROCESSORINPUT.
Requisitos
Requisito | Valor |
---|---|
Cliente mínimo com suporte | Disponível no Windows Vista e versões posteriores dos sistemas operacionais Windows. |
Cabeçalho | d3dumddi.h (inclua D3dumddi.h) |